The India-Pakistan rivalry continues to dominate the 2025 Asia Cup. The two arch-rivals have already met twice in the tournament, and fans are wondering—could there be a third showdown in the final? Let’s look at the current scenario and the path ahead.
Super Four Standings So Far-
India: On top of the Super Four table with 2 points and a +0.689 NRR, after defeating Pakistan by 6 wickets.
-
Pakistan: At the bottom with a –0.689 NRR, following their loss to India.
-
Bangladesh: In second place with a win in their first Super Four match.
-
Sri Lanka: In third, with a negative run rate.
-
India’s path: If India continues its winning form and defeats Bangladesh (Sept 24) and Sri Lanka (Sept 26), their place in the final will be sealed.
-
Pakistan’s path: Pakistan must win both its remaining matches—vs Sri Lanka (Sept 23) and vs Bangladesh (Sept 25)—to stay in contention.
-
If both India and Pakistan win their upcoming fixtures, fans will witness an India vs Pakistan final on September 28, 2025.
Bangladesh has already opened the Super Four with a win. Their performance against both India and Pakistan will be decisive in shaping the final line-up.
